Software Development Manager, Embedded Linux - Amazon Scout
- San Francisco, CA
DESCRIPTION
Are you inspired by building new technologies to benefit customers? Do you dream of being at the forefront of robotics and autonomous system technology? Would you enjoy working in a fast paced, highly collaborative, start-up like environment? If you answered yes to any of these then you've got to check out the Amazon Scout team.
We've been hard at work developing a new, fully-electric delivery system - Amazon Scout - designed to get packages to customers using autonomous delivery devices. These devices were created by Amazon, are the size of a small cooler, and roll along sidewalks at a walking pace. We developed Amazon Scout at our research and development lab in Seattle, ensuring the devices can safely and efficiently navigate around pets, pedestrians and anything else in their path.
The Amazon Scout team shares a passion for innovation using advanced technologies, a love of solving complex challenges, and a desire to impact customers in a meaningful way. We're looking for individuals who like dealing with ambiguity, solving hard, large scale problems, and working in a startup like environment. To learn more about Amazon Scout, check out our Amazon Day One Blog post here: http://amazon.com/scout
As an Embedded Software Manager, you will lead a team of embedded software engineers who are building the fundamental infrastructure for the Scout autonomous robot. You will have an enormous opportunity to make a large impact on the design, architecture, and implementation of our cutting-edge autonomous delivery robot!
You should be a self-starter with a bias towards independent problem solving. Clear communication and prioritization will be important as you lead your team through the planning, design, and delivery of kernel and driver-level projects. You will influence the future direction of the Amazon Scout Robot Software team and will leverage your previous experience to set a bold roadmap for your team.
If you're entrepreneurial and want to build and own transformative technology-driven products, join us in making history!
Key Responsibilities:
• Lead the design, development and verification of Embedded Linux systems
• Participate in design reviews, API development, and documentation
• Work with new technologies that are vital to product development
• Deliver investigation plans and reports, architectural documents, design specs, software and firmware source code, build scripts
• Represent the embedded software team in key leadership and design reviews
• Work in a collaborative environment with other software and hardware leaders to build the next generation of autonomous robots!
BASIC QUALIFICATIONS
• Bachelor's degree in Electrical Engineering, Computer Science, Computer Engineering or related field
• 4+ years of embedded software development experience
• 4+ Years of engineering management experience
PREFERRED QUALIFICATIONS
• Experience in coding in C/C++
• Experience in Computer Science fundamentals: object-oriented design, data structures, algorithm design, problem solving, and complexity analysis
• Experience designing and implementing Embedded Linux platforms in a production environment.
• Experience with Linux kernel development, Linux device drivers and device trees.
• Experience in one or more of these areas: networking, cameras, sensors and associated algorithm development
• Strong debugging/trouble-shooting skills of Embedded Linux systems
• Experience with real time debugging tools (software and hardware)
• Experience with ARM based SOC architecture
• Excellent judgment, organizational, and problem solving skills
• Can mentor other software developers to maintain architectural vision and software quality
• Excellent verbal and written communication skills
• Comfortable taking initiative and working across teams
• Excellence in technical communication with peers, partners, and non-technical co-workers
Amazon is committed to a diverse and inclusive workplace. Amazon is an equal opportunity employer and does not discriminate on the basis of race, national origin, gender, gender identity, sexual orientation, protected veteran status, disability, age, or other legally protected status. For individuals with disabilities who would like to request an accommodation, please visit https://www.amazon.jobs/en/disability/us
We believe passionately that employing a diverse workforce is central to our success and we make recruiting decisions based on your experience and skills. We welcome applications from all members of society irrespective of age, gender, disability, sexual orientation, race, religion or belief.
Back to top